Now up to 4th on the dirt Drift event... PB scores are pretty much tied with 1st place but so many weeks left I will be lucky to still be in the top 100 by the end I think. Its a bit silly but I've worked out Drift now - go as slow as you can! Its about maximising your time sideways (aka going slow, getting the right angle and staying on line). Explains why a stupid high horespower burnout machine ('62 Special) is in top spot (And why comfort hard tyres get higher scores).

Noticed something just now.

If you complete a race, win and restart, via the new restart race button gt5 will only accredit the car you are driving for the initial win. All other wins after this will not count to your cars tally until you exit out and load the track again...
